RHSA-2013:0596Medium

Red Hat Security Advisory: openstack-keystone security, bug fix, and enhancement update

Published
March 5, 2013
Last Modified
July 30, 2026

🔗 CVE IDs covered (3)

📋 Description

CVE-2013-0282 — Keystone: EC2-style authentication accepts disabled user/tenants CVE-2013-1664 — bindings: Internal entity expansion in Python XML libraries inflicts DoS vulnerabilities CVE-2013-1665 — bindings: External entity expansion in Python XML libraries inflicts potential security flaws and DoS vulnerabilities
